Alney "Red" Easley Jr.

January 26, 1934 — September 8, 2019

Alney “Red” Easley Jr., 85, of Wellington, died Sunday, September 8, 2019 at The Elms Retirement Village.

Red was born January 26, 1934 in Medina, Ohio to Alney Sr. and Lois {Krittenden} Easley.

He was a member of the US Army from 1958 to 1960.

Red married Martha Deiss on September 3, 1967.  She died January 1, 2018.

He worked for the Nabisco Company, the TJ Paisley Company and Gamauf Hardware. Red was a master fisherman, woodworker and wine maker.

Red will be deeply missed by brother Larry; sisters Ruth, Isabelle, Betty and Shirley; niece Mary and nephew Larry May.

Red was preceded in death by his wife, brother Ralph and sister JoAnn.
